‘Your State Parks Day’ Volunteer Opportunity at all State Parks

The annual ‘Your State Parks Day’ is Saturday, September 30th.  Interested individuals can volunteer their time to participate in special projects to address various preservation and beautification efforts of Georgia State Parks and Historic Sites. In addition to all of the other state parks and historic sites, there will be opportunities to volunteer both at Sloppy Floyd State Park in Summerville and Cloudland Canyon in Rising Fawn. Project Red Light Bike Ride

The second annual ‘Project Red Light bike ride’ will be held on the 30th of this month. It will start at the Summerville Boy Scout Hut and end at Desoto State Falls. Registration starts at 11 AM and kick stands will go up at 2 PM.

The cost is $20 per bike and $10 per passenger. BBQ plates will coleslaw and baked beans will be sold after the ride for $10 each, and shirts will be sold for $20. There will be a family-friendly event at the end with a live band, door prizes, bounce houses, face painting, cotton candy, hair coloring, and hot dog plates. Kids get in free. All proceeds will go to local firefighters.
